fixes #____ - subscriptions manifest, dates
Merge pull request #122 from thomasmckay/create-subs
fixes #16493 - create manifest in portal
Merge pull request #123 from thomasmckay/subnets-io
fixes #16501 - subnets import not setting proxies
Changed the vcr recording by adding --reload-cache to all the hammer commands. This hopefully will avoid the intermittent failures due to fetching the v2.json.
Merge pull request #121 from thomasmckay/fastgettext
fixes #16428 - set domain FastGettext
+ Initialize FastGettext properly when called under Thread.new()+ Changed pot/po files from _ to -
Merge pull request #120 from bkearney/bkearney/16339
Fixes #16339 - Adds in string extraction and a couple of cleanups
Merge pull request #119 from thomasmckay/16281-actkey-subs
fixes #16281 - add --itemized-subscriptions to activation-keys
Merge pull request #118 from thomasmckay/15752-coe
fixes #15752 - continue processing even if error
Merge pull request #117 from thomasmckay/15743-attach-subs
fixes #15743 - import and export of subscriptions one-per-line
Merge pull request #113 from thomasmckay/subs-rework
fixes #15740 - move red hat repo enable to products
This PR also fixed some aspects of the new VCR tests
Merge pull request #116 from thomasmckay/15916-vcr
fixes #15916 - infrastructure to switch tests to use vcr
Switching to VCR will allow both running against a live server (as the existing tests do now) or to run in pre-recorded mode.
Setting initial code coverage to 26%
Added default rake task to run rubocop and test
Fixes #15748 - Test on Ruby 2.1-2.2 (#115)
Merge pull request #114 from thomasmckay/15744-v2.1
fixes #15744 - master is now v2.1
Merge pull request #108 from thomasmckay/15310-export-subs
fixes #15310 - export Red Hat subscriptions as comments
Merge pull request #106 from thomasmckay/14265-hv-guests
fixes #14265 - import content hosts with hypervisors and guests
Merge pull request #107 from thomasmckay/15104-subs-export
fixes #15104 - properly find Red Hat products
Merge pull request #104 from thomasmckay/hostgroup-export
fixes #14389 - import/export host groups
Merge pull request #103 from thomasmckay/14162-hide-em
fixes #14162 - hide unsupported sub-commands and options
Merge pull request #105 from thomasmckay/media-io
fixes #14390 - installation-media i/o
+ updated for ruby 2.0.0+ updated README+ fixed rubocop+ updated tests+ based on feedback switched to default being unsupported for new commands
hammer-cli-csv v2.0.0
Merge pull request #102 from thomasmckay/moar-hosts
myriad changes in attempt to get import working against master/develop
Merge pull request #101 from thomasmckay/rex
remote execution
job-templates
+ export job-templates+ import job-templates+ other odds&bits
Merge pull request #100 from thomasmckay/rex
general fixes
+ updated travis to match hammer-cli-katello
+ rex wipoperating-systems - additional columns, redmine issues created+ allow --dir w/ individual --
Merge pull request #99 from thomasmckay/version
version 1.0.2
Merge pull request #98 from thomasmckay/orgs-update
repo enable for subscriptions that don't have release version
Merge pull request #96 from thomasmckay/smart-proxies
update smart-proxies, begin job-templates
wip
Merge pull request #94 from beav/readme-update
README updates
Merge pull request #95 from thomasmckay/host-groups
+ import/export host-groups
+ import/export host-groups+ import/export domains+ fixed --organization search options+ updated export args+ content-views test+ updated test data+ export job-templates+ removed COUNT column from export
I consistently forget to update csv.yml :cat2:. This patch adds an additionalinstallation step to update that file.
Merge pull request #93 from thomasmckay/vegan
updates to tests and functionality
+ added export containers+ export content-view-filters erratum and rpm types+ 'hammer csv import' now works from --dir https://somewhere+ 'hammer csv import' tests and fixes
Merge pull request #92 from thomasmckay/organic
+ hosts export w/ organization
+ hosts export w/ organization+ export / import puppet facts+ added examples dir+ subscriptions can have optional Organization column to be filled w/ --organization+ content-view-filters export date based errata+ read from http/file/stdin+ removed gettext from gemspec (prevented installation)
Merge pull request #91 from thomasmckay/6.0-to-6.1
many updates in support of changes to api and other "productization" aspects
+ removed copyright and old comments that had been moved to README
+ updated api call to add host collections to activation key
+ adding import/export settings
+ clean up options --organization and --file
+ added deprecation for --csv-file and --csv-export...
Merge pull request #90 from ehelms/remove-spec
Move to katello-packaging
Merge pull request #89 from thomasmckay/v-1.0.1
release 1.0.1
Merge pull request #88 from ehelms/config
Refs #9848: Move config file to config directory and provide via gem
Merge pull request #87 from thomasmckay/import-server
retrieve cli arg params properly
Merge pull request #86 from thomasmckay/wait-task
waits for remote content-host task
refactor
centralized requires
clarify w/ vars
re-styled
Merge pull request #85 from thomasmckay/csv-plugin
updated to work with foreman-csv plugin
fixed roles
updated comment
Merge pull request #84 from thomasmckay/splice-fixes
splice fixes
correct products
Merge pull request #81 from thomasmckay/products-export
product repositories export fixed
Merge pull request #82 from thomasmckay/provisioning-templates
updated import / export provisioning templates
Merge pull request #80 from thomasmckay/splice
adding spacewalk splice import
+ parsing product mapping and pem+ hypervisor / guest+ host collections+ facts
rubocop and spacewalk reference
Merge pull request #79 from thomasmckay/no-sync-flag
optional disable or product sync, refactor task calls
+ refactor task calls in content-views+ publish and promote working of content-views+ various locale strings+ corrected export of act keys+ --sync option and :products_sync: configuration
spelling of sync, plus count description...
Merge pull request #78 from thomasmckay/sync-plans
usability and fixes
+ import/export sync plans+ added --organization to some resources+ export and import red hat products in addition to custom ones to allow them to be sync'ed+ import updated to include products and subscriptions properly+ fixed products cli args...
Merge pull request #77 from thomasmckay/sam-systems
export content-hosts
+ export content-hosts+ renamed some code from 'system' to 'content-host'+ handle different server versions and their search syntax+ add --organization to limit some commands to specific orgs
Automatic commit of package [rubygem-hammer_cli_csv] minor release [1.0.0-5].
Remove the Fedora check that evaluates to true on EL7
Automatic commit of package [rubygem-hammer_cli_csv] minor release [1.0.0-4].
Remove gem_dir definition.
Automatic commit of package [rubygem-hammer_cli_csv] minor release [1.0.0-3].
Adding default configuration for tags.
Automatic commit of package [rubygem-hammer_cli_csv] minor release [1.0.0-2].
Adding basic releasers configuration for Koji.
Switch to ReleaseTagger for tito
Merge pull request #76 from ehelms/fix-spec-requires
Require rubygems-devel in all cases.
Merge pull request #75 from komidore64/new-version
bump to version 1.0.0
Automatic commit of package [rubygem-hammer_cli_csv] release [1.0.0-1].
Merge pull request #74 from bkearney/bkearney/i18n2
Plugins should support i18n. This commit adds the basics, but the engine...
Plugins should support i18n. This commit adds the basics, but the engineers need to start translating code
Merge pull request #72 from ehelms/fix-spec
Require ruby release for EL7.